New Orleans musician Sleep Habits, the project of Alan Howard, returns with ‘Antique Mall,’ the first single from his upcoming EP Mourning Doves, due out May 10, 2025, via Kiln Recordings.

Blending mellow acoustic tones with warm, focused synths, ‘Antique Mall’ finds Howard reflecting on memory, change, and the emotional weight of holding onto the past. The track uses the symbolic setting of an antique mall to explore how memories shape identity, even as time moves forward. With hazy textures and spacious production, the song leans into a sense of liminality—honoring what once was while acknowledging the need to move on.

Howard reflects on ‘Antique Mall’:

“At the time I wrote this song, I was coming to terms with the fact that you can’t carry everything with you throughout your life. The physical space of the antique mall symbolizes that feeling. With that symbol as its base, the song explores allowing yourself to hold onto the reverence of memory and acknowledge how it has shaped you while letting go of the idealistic sense of the ‘good ol’ days’.”

‘Antique Mall’ is out now.
